## Service Accounts: Tax-Rate Lookup Cache

Welcome aboard! The Larkspur tax-rate cache refreshes nightly via the ratesync service account. If rates look stale, check the refresh job first — it's almost always a missed cron run, not the upstream. To query the cache directly or trigger a manual refresh, use the key below.

gateway credential: kto23_dolYgAScEh2TaPOlStqOl98

## Changelog — CalMerge 3.8.1

Rotated the signing key used by the CalMerge conflict-resolution service after we discovered that stale tokens were letting the Driftwood calendar connector replay old sync events, producing duplicate-meeting conflicts for several tenants. All connectors must re-register; the old key was revoked at cutover and any payload signed with it is now rejected. Future maintainers: rotation steps live in the ops handbook under "CalMerge rotation." The replacement key, effective immediately, is as follows.

signing key of bagap-yawep = bky13_TbfT6ZMUoGJo2

# Break-Glass: Catalog Cache Invalidation

Scope: the Pinrow product catalog at Veldstone Retail. If stale prices persist after a purge and the Hollowmere invalidation queue is wedged, use break-glass to flush the edge tier directly. Contractors: get verbal sign-off from the catalog lead first. Steps: open the Hollowmere admin shell, select emergency-flush, confirm the tenant, and run it once — repeated flushes thrash the origin. Access is logged and expires after 20 minutes. Unseal the admin shell with the passphrase below.

recovery phrase for kahop-tajog: istix-casvan